500 meters is 0.310686 miles. Thank you for asking
0.3106 miles is equal to 500 meters
500 Meters = 0.310685596118667 Miles !
500 meters = 1,640.41995 feet.
500 nanometers is equal to .000001 meter or .0005 millimeters.
Hi there! 500 meters is 0.310685596 miles.
